      <description>The 325th Fighter Wing will host Checkered Flag 26-2 at Tyndall Air Force Base, bringing together 14 Air Force, Navy and Marine Corps units to conduct large-scale, integrated air-to-air training. The exercise focuses on combining fourth- and fifth-generation aircraft in a contested environment to strengthen readiness, interoperability and rapid global response capabilities. Participants will also support live-fire training through the Weapons System Evaluation Program, providing realistic combat training that enhances the force’s ability to generate and deliver airpower.&lt;br/&gt;

      <description>ACC’s Operations Directorate (ACC/A3) stood up a first-of-its-kind Artificial Intelligence Integration Division April 1, at Joint Base Langley-Eustis, Va. The new division, designated A3AI, will serve as the command's central authority for artificial intelligence. It is tasked with establishing AI policy, validating tools for operational use, delivering training to ACC wings, and synchronizing efforts with Department of the Air Force and Department of War AI initiatives.&lt;br/&gt;
